So I got to see WICKED..

Sitting on my own, in my A reserve seat (which I booked online the night before!!) - 8 rows from the front, a little towards the side of the Regent Theatre - I was still in a state of disbelief! That I am actually going to be seeing 'Wicked'! I was a little nervous that I may be getting understudies for the show (it was matinee afterall) - I did not buy the Souvenier Program to 'compare' the faces with! I had opted to buy a 'Wicked" T-Shirt instead!

Looking at my watch, I knew I may miss out on the curtain call at shows end (3.45pm) seeing that I would have to flee back to the hotel by 4.00pm to catch a cab with the rest of the family, for the wedding scheduled for 4.30pm! For that very reason, I had 'dressed' up already - all made up, my LBD and comfy flats. Grateful for Melbourne's cold weather, I needn't worry about sweating arm-pits!

Right now, at exactly 1.00pm, it's showtime! Curtains up and the all too familiar overture starts playing, followed by the opening number "No one mourns the wicked". I remember I am wearing mascara, so I do not cry! There's something unexplainable about hearing musicals live - always brings me to tears! (I cried through 2 hours of 'Miss Saigon')

I remember being totally distraught upon learning of Wicked closing its Australian/Melbourne run in January of this year. Whilst in Perth, I had toyed with the idea of escaping for a weekend away in Melbourne, just to catch the show before it ended. Usually for shows like this in NYC or London, it runs for a minimum of 18 months. I wasn't too sure if Melbourne would do likewise! Sure glad they did!

Except for the guy who played Fiyero (I believe was an understudy) , I had the privilege of watching the principal Australian cast. Still with the original NYC cast in my head, my only 'complaint' was the Aussie casts' singing were a little thin, comparatively. The ensemble, however, was brilliant and just so riveting that I couldn't keep my eyes off them! Their quirky costumes and dances were captivating that I sometimes missed some scenes with the main characters! Thank goodness I already know the plot of the story pretty well, to not miss out on too much!

As planned, at 3.45pm the curtain fell and I flew out of the theatre!

We made it to the wedding at 4.30pm.
